<em><u>The main reason that the Age of Revolution initially failed to achieve widespread change in some nations of Europe was because few people supported the revolutions. </u></em>

Further Explanations:

Age of Revolution extended approximately forty years and during that span, numerous revolutionary movements took pace that rehabilitated the societies of America and Europe. Enlightenment is deliberated to be the preliminary point of the age and was later followed by the “French Revolution” of 1789 and all other substantial revolution along with its conflict.

The era saw the transformation of the administration from absolute monarchy to democratic government with a written constitution. When Napoleon came to power, he prolonged the French Revolution and continued his conquest of Continental Europe. Though Napoleon imposed several modern notions such as “Civil code” and “Equality before the law” in the occupied regions. His rigorous military annexation prompted the rebel in Germany and Spain. Thus we can determine that the Age of Revolution did left a deep impact on society but failed due to lack of backing from the local mass.
